      Electrical Design Engineer Interview

      Nov 16, 2021
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      Freeport, TX
      No offer
      Negative experience
      Difficult inter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at BASF (Freeport, TX) in Jun 2020

      Interview

      I was interviewed during the Corona Virus big layoff time period back in June 2020. I am in Houston Job Market and because of negetive oil prices so many companies laid of engineers. So BASF took the advantage of that treated us very bad in the interview. We were waiting outside the building entrance they were calling us one after the other like the 1930s depression area job search. Their attitude in the interview room was very rude. They could have spaced the interview at least 30 minutes apart. They wil call you after the interview not to offer the job and tell you how bad you are.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      How do you reduce Arc Flash? As an Engineer have you done any wiring prints?
